Course Content

• ADA Compliance Fundamentals and University Responsibilities
• Website Accessibility: WCAG 2.1 and ADA Standards for Higher Education
• Assistive Technology and its Integration into the University Learning Environment
• Accessible Course Materials and Educational Resources: Creating Inclusive Content
• ADA Compliance in Physical Spaces: Building Accessibility and Universal Design
• Managing ADA Complaints and Investigations in a University Setting
• Training Faculty and Staff on ADA Compliance: Best Practices and Strategies
• Legal Aspects of ADA Compliance for Universities and Section 504
• Accessible Information Technology for Students with Disabilities
